Kinds Of Roofing Products
When it concerns choosing roofing materials, you'll locate a selection of options, each with one-of-a-kind benefits and disadvantages.
Asphalt roof shingles are a preferred selection due to their cost and ease of installation. They are available in various shades and styles, making it easy to match your home's aesthetic. However, they mightn't be the most durable option in severe weather.
Metal roofing, on the other hand, offers superb long life and weather condition resistance. It's lightweight and can reflect sunlight, which might help reduce power prices. While the ahead of time expense can be greater, you'll benefit from its durability in the long run.
If you're trying to find a green alternative, think about slate or clay floor tiles. They're unbelievably sturdy and can last for over a century. Nevertheless, remember that they need a strong architectural assistance because of their weight, and installation can be extra complex.
Last but not least, there's wood roof covering, commonly made from cedar or redwood. It offers a lovely, natural look but needs normal upkeep to prevent rot and bug damage.
Ultimately, your selection ought to straighten with your budget plan, visual preferences, and the certain environment in your location.
Expense Comparison of Materials
Generally, home owners find that the cost of roofing materials differs substantially based upon the type you select. Asphalt shingles often tend to be one of the most economical choice, setting you back around $90 to $100 per square. They're extensively offered and relatively very easy to install, making them a prominent choice.

For a costs alternative, slate roof covering can cost anywhere from $600 to $1,500 per square, providing outstanding longevity and visual allure. Nonetheless, this comes at a large rate, and installation can be labor-intensive.
Eventually, it's important to stabilize your budget plan with the longevity and maintenance demands of each material. Spending carefully now can conserve you cash in the long run, so ensure to examine both your existing monetary circumstance and future needs prior to making a decision.

Next, consider the lifespan of the material. Some roof choices, like steel and ceramic tile, can last 50 years or more, while asphalt shingles generally last around 20 years. A longer life expectancy may save you money in the long run, even if the ahead of time cost is greater.
Additionally, consider the visual charm. Your roofing system considerably influences your home's visual appeal, so select a style and color that matches your style.
Don't forget power performance. Some products show sunlight and can help in reducing cooling down prices, which is a big plus during hot summers.
Finally, check regional building codes and laws. Some areas have limitations on certain products, so it's important to research study before choosing.
